    i have a ford 9' rear that i do not know the make and model it came from . Unable to match the drums at the local parts stores in my area . Here are the measurements drum height 3 1/8'' , bolt pattern 5/4 1/2'', drum length across 12 1/8'' OD, inside 11'' ID, brake friction surface 2 1/8'' high, drum holes 9/16'', drum center circle 2 7/8'', I HAVE BEEN TOLD THAT IT MAY HAVE COME FROM A 1957 -59 FORD RANCHERO ?
